Merts: Restriction of the weapons ship sent to Ukraine has been canceled
The German Chancellor said in an interview that his country, along with Britain, the United States and France, had abolished previous restrictions on Ukraine’s weapons, allowing Kiev to use these weapons to attack the depths of Russian soil.
According to RCO News Agency, German Chancellor Friedrich Merts said in an interview that the US, France, Britain and Germany had lifted restrictions on the weapons to Ukraine.
These countries had previously refused to do so to prevent NATO’s direct conflict with Russia.
Rihanosti News agency reported that Merts said in an interview: “There is no restriction on the weapons to Ukraine, neither from Britain, nor from France, nor us nor America.” This means that Ukraine can now defend itself, including, for example, by attacking the military positions of Russian soil. Ukraine was not allowed to do so.
Ukraine had significantly exacerbated its drone attacks inside Russia last week, with at least four UAVs being intercepted over Russian territory on Tuesday and Friday and hundreds of other drones were destroyed on the weekend. Russian President Vladimir Putin’s helicopter was reportedly caught up in the center of a widespread UAV attack while visiting the Korsk area on Tuesday.
In response, the Russian military launched a major attack on a drone and missile plant in Kiev on Saturday, followed by other attacks on Ukraine’s military facilities on Sunday.
One of the concerns of the US, British and French government about allowing Ukraine to use long -range weapons such as Storm Dado and Atkams has been to enter a direct conflict with Russia, which is a nuclear power.
Although Russian President Vladimir Putin has repeatedly implicitly outlined the use of nuclear weapons, and the West has passed a few red lines such as providing F-1 tanks and fighters to Ukraine, no action has been observed by Russia.
In another part of the conversation, Merts said that he would no longer understand the goals of the Zionist army in Gaza.
“The current level of Israeli attacks on Gaza is no longer justified by fighting Hamas,” he said.
The German Chancellor said: “I am talking to Netanyahu this week and will ask him not to expand the attacks on Gaza.
